Slide 2. Vehicle maintenance.

  • Why maintain the car?.

            Regular car maintenance is essential to ensure its safety and optimal performance. A well-maintained vehicle not only reduces the risk of unexpected breakdowns on the road, but also helps prevent accidents. Worn or defective components, such as brakes, tires and lights, can compromise the responsiveness and efficiency of the vehicle.

            In addition, proper maintenance also involves periodically checking and changing essential fluids, such as oil and brake fluid, which ensures proper performance of mechanical systems.

            In short, constant care of the car not only prolongs its service life, but is also a crucial measure to ensure the safety of all occupants and other road users.

  1. Key points of car maintenance.

            Although the maintenance of the whole car is important, these are the points that should be checked the most:

  1. Shock absorbers.

            They are in charge of providing the necessary stability and comfort to the vehicle when it is in motion.

            This element should also be checked regularly because they wear out over time. In general terms, it is advisable to check them every certain number of kilometers traveled, depending on the brand and the manufacturer's recommendations.

  1. Wiper blades.

            In rainy situations, wiper blades play a vital role in visibility. It is essential to make sure that they sweep efficiently and evacuate water properly, so that visibility is not lost.

            The replacement of these wiper blades is especially recommended after the summer, as high temperatures can affect their components.

  1. Filters.

            These accessories are determinant in the durability of the different systems that use them, in the engine they retain the particles coming from the wear that can diminish the performance of the same one. Some fuel filters need to be clean for the system to be able to supply fuel correctly.

  1. Tires.

      As we already know, the tire is the direct contact of the car with the road, for this reason, special attention must be paid to these components that are synonymous with comfort and safety. The quality of the tire is paramount, as well as the air pressure and alignment.

            It is important to follow a schedule for tire inspection and maintenance and to replace them at the first signs of deterioration and wear.

  1. Brakes.

            The safety and integrity of the driver and the vehicle depend on the good condition of the brake system. Preventive maintenance and replacement of the components that need it, should be done in a timely manner and by an expert, this system should also be given priority.

  1. Lubricants.

            The use of this component guarantees the life and durability of the engine, and its relationship with the operation of other systems makes it one of the priorities to be taken into account when planning the maintenance of the vehicle. It protects the internal parts of the engine from premature wear and serves as a vehicle to conduct the metal splinters resulting from the friction of the parts to the filter.

            In the latest generation of vehicles, the time of use of lubricants, which are mostly of synthetic origin, has been increased.

  1. Lighting.

            A vehicle's lighting system must work properly in order to drive safely, especially at night. This makes it a priority to keep the lighting system in good condition. Checking all lights monthly and cleaning their outer surface ensures proper operation.

  1. Exhaust system and catalytic converters.

            Exhaust systems have a double mission: to reduce polluting emissions and to reduce noise. Driving with defective catalytic converters can increase the risk of fire and cause intoxication. It is recommended to check them after 60,000 kilometers to avoid damage.

  1. Timing belt.

            The timing belt synchronizes the engine timing and its breakage can cause serious breakdowns. By following the manufacturer's instructions and changing it at the recommended intervals, expensive problems can be avoided.

  • Environment: Responsibility when replacing components.

            Some vehicle parts are considered hazardous waste and must be properly managed. Workshops follow strict regulations for the recovery and recycling of these wastes. When changing components, you should go to the nearest clean point, and when "retiring" a car, do it responsibly.

            These are the determining aspects and points to ensure a comprehensive maintenance of our vehicle, thus contributing to safety, durability and care for the environment. Performing periodic reviews and acting responsibly at each stage of automotive maintenance should always be a priority.
